  • Assistant Professor of School Psychology, Special Title Series
    8G030:Educational, School and Counseling Psych
    University of Kentucky

    The Department of Educational, School, and Counseling Psychology in the College of Education at the University of Kentucky invites applications for a full-time Special Title assistant professor position in School Psychology. The appointment is a nine-month appointment, effective August 16, 2025. The position is in a tenure-eligible Special Title Series which provides eligibility for promotion and tenure. Salary, fringe benefits, and initial operating support are competitive with other leading land-grant universities.

    Qualifications include an earned Ph.D. degree in counseling or clinical psychology or a related field. Responsibilities will be divided between teaching and service, with faculty in this position typically expected to teach a 3/3 course load.

    Responsibilities include the following:


    • Teach 3/3 course load for the following courses:


    EDP 305 Introduction to Counseling Skills (undergraduate);
    EDP 533 History and Systems of Psychology;
    EDP 622 Supervision of School Psychology;
    EDP 675 Practicum in School Psychology;
    EDP 658: Problems in Educational Psychology
    (Advanced Theories for children, youth and/or families);
    EDP 683 Special Topics: Supervision of Assessment



    • Provide assessment supervision, training, and services related to the Community Mental Health Clinic within the Department of Educational, School, and Counseling Psychology;

    • Seek extramural funding;

    • Serve on student advising committees; and

    • Provide service to the department, college, university, and profession.


    Interested applicants should submit an application at www.uky.edu/ukjobs and include the following materials:


    • Detailed cover letter noting academic credentials and professional experience related to the responsibilities for this position - upload under Cover Letter;

    • Curriculum vitae - upload under Curriculum Vitae;

    • Names and contact information for three professional references -upload under References.


    Review of applications will begin May 13, 2025. Questions regarding the position may be directed to Dr. David Pascale-Hague, Search Committee Chair (david.hague@uky.edu).
